¿Cuánto cuesta alquilar un apartamento en Phoenix?
| Dormitorios | Precio Promedio | Más barato | Más caro |
|---|---|---|---|
| Apartamentos Estudio en Phoenix | $1,339 | $599 | $4,063 |
| Apartamentos 1 Dormitorios en Phoenix | $1,564 | $636 | $10,000+ |
| Apartamentos 2 Dormitorios en Phoenix | $1,913 | $649 | $10,000+ |
| Apartamentos 3 Dormitorios en Phoenix | $2,469 | $675 | $10,000+ |
| Apartamentos 4 Dormitorios en Phoenix | $2,764 | $750 | $10,000+ |
| Apartamentos 5 Dormitorios en Phoenix | $8,061 | $999 | $10,000+ |
